Mark Siegal, an evolutionary systems biologist in the Center for Genomics and Systems Biology and the Department of Biology at NYU, is in the first cohort of recipients of the MIRA award from the National Institute of General Medical Sciences. The five-year MIRA ("Maximizing Investigators’ Research Award"), issued under NIH's "Outstanding Investigator" mechanism, funds labs not projects, to enable investigators to pursue more ambitious, creative lines of research. The MIRA award will support the Siegal lab's study of genetic and nongenetic variation in complex traits.
